During the 2020-2021 academic year, Stonehill College handed out 7 bachelor's degrees in general chemistry. This is an increase of 40% over the previous year when 5 degrees were handed out.
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the chemistry majors at Stonehill College.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, 7 chemistry majors earned their bachelor's degree from Stonehill. Of these graduates, 71% were men and 29% were women.
